Ps:焦点堆栈

焦点堆栈 Focus Stacking是一种摄影和图像处理技术,通过合并多张在不同焦距拍摄的照片来创建一张具有更大景深的图像,特别适用于微距摄影、风景摄影和任何需要在整个场景中保持尖锐对焦的情况。

  ◆  ◆

拍摄注意事项

1、使用三脚架

为了确保图像之间对齐,使用三脚架保持相机稳定是必要的。

2、手动对焦

手动调整焦点,从最近的焦点开始,逐步移动到最远的焦点。每次调整后拍摄一张照片。

焦点的移动应该是均匀的,以确保整个场景都能被覆盖。

3、保持光线一致

确保拍摄过程中光线保持一致,避免由于光线变化导致的曝光不一致的问题。

4、使用固定设置

除了对焦点外,其它相机设置(如光圈、快门速度、ISO)在整个拍摄过程中应保持不变。

  ◆  ◆

在 Photoshop 中的处理步骤

焦点堆栈技术的工作原理是,通过将一系列焦点各不相同的图像合并,只选取每张图像中对焦最锐利的部分,然后将这些部分叠加到一起,形成一张全范围都锐利对焦的图像。

1、导入照片

首先要将所有拍摄的照片导入到同一 Photoshop 文档,每张照片作为单独的图层堆叠在一起,构成图像堆栈。

比较高效的方法是使用“将文件载入堆栈”脚本命令。

Ps菜单:文件/脚本/将文件载入堆栈

Scripts/Load Files into Stack

aadabe496cd5f1b6ae19a7cbe88a3606.png

不要勾选“载入图层后创建智能对象”。

若勾选“尝试自动对齐源图像”,则可省掉步骤 2。

也可以在其它软件中将照片作为图层导入到 Photoshop 中。

在 Adobe Lightroom 中选中所有相关照片,右击并选择“在应用程序中编辑/在 Photoshop 中作为图层打开”。

在 Adobe Bridge 中选中所有相关照片,使用菜单:工具/Photoshop/将文件载入 Photoshop 图层”。

2、自动对齐图层

选中所有图层后,执行“自动对齐图层”命令,以确保所有图像都精准对齐。

Ps菜单:编辑/自动对齐图层

Edit/Auto-Align Layers

3、自动混合图层

选中所有图层后,执行“自动混合图层”命令。

Ps菜单:编辑/自动混合图层

Edit/Auto-Blend Layers

1d7d33fff7becaff84879f128be2f343.png

选中“堆叠图像”,勾选“无缝色调和颜色”,如上图所示。

若勾选“内容识别填充透明区域”,将在“图层”面板上额外创建一个盖印图层,并使用内容识别技术来填充在合并过程中产生的任何透明区域。

4、最终调整

由于“自动混合图层”是通过图层蒙版去遮挡每个图层的不同区域,有必要的话,可以手动盖印图层(快捷键:Ctrl + Alt + Shift + E),并使用仿制图章工具等修正一些小区域,以确保图像的连贯性和自然过渡。

完成焦点堆栈合并后,可能需要进行最终的色彩校正、对比度调整或锐化,以提高图像质量。

5efd95dbda9a876659d286eadd785f34.jpeg

“点赞有美意,赞赏是鼓励”

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/469627.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

《小强升职记:时间管理故事书》阅读笔记

目录 前言 一、你的时间都去哪儿了 1.1 你真的很忙吗 1.2 如何记录和分析时间日志 1.3 如何找到自己的价值观 二、无压工作法 2.1 传说中的“四象限法则 2.2 衣柜整理法 三、行动时遇到问题怎么办? 3.1 臣服与拖延 3.2 如何做到要事第一? 3.…

【一周年】我的创作纪念日

今天,是我成为创作者的第366天,不知不觉,来CSDN已经一年啦~ 在这个特殊的日子,也给大家讲讲我的创作故事。 一、机缘 起初,刚认识CSDN时,我的高中生涯刚结束,顺利从一名懵懂的高中生变身为一名懵…

Linux第53步_移植ST公司的linux内核第5步_系统镜像打包并烧录到EMMC

本节主要学习系统镜像打包,然后将打包文件烧录到EMMC测试。 1、创建bootfs文件夹 1)、打开第1个终端 输入“ls回车” 输入“cd linux/回车”,切换到“linux”目录 输入“ls回车”,列出“linux”目录下的文件和文件夹 输入“cd atk-mp1/…

Go语言中的加密艺术:深入解析crypto/subtle库

Go语言中的加密艺术:深入解析crypto/subtle库 引言crypto/subtle库概览ConstantTimeCompare函数深入解析ConstantTimeSelect函数应用详解ConstantTimeLessOrEq函数实践指南安全编程实践性能优化与最佳实践与其他加密库的比较总结 引言 在当今快速发展的互联网时代&…

localStorage、sessionStorage、cookie区别

localStorage: localStorage 的生命周期是永久的,关闭页面或浏览器之后 localStorage 中的数据也不会消失。localStorage 除非主动删除数据,否则数据永远不会消失 sessionStorage: sessionStorage 的生命周期是仅在当前会话下有效。sessionStorage 引入…

C语言第二十四弹---指针(八)

✨个人主页: 熬夜学编程的小林 💗系列专栏: 【C语言详解】 【数据结构详解】 指针 1、数组和指针笔试题解析 1.1、字符数组 1.1.1、代码1: 1.1.2、代码2: 1.1.3、代码3: 1.1.4、代码4: 1…

C++的进阶泛型编程学习(1):函数模板的基本概念和机制

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 前言一、模板1.1 模板的概念1.1.1 形象的解释:模板就是通用的模具,目的是提高通用性1.1.1 模板的特点:1.1.2 综述模板的作用 1.2…

OpenGL-ES 学习(1)---- AlphaBlend

AlphaBlend OpenGL-ES 混合本质上是将 2 个片元的颜色进行调和(一般是求和操作),产生一个新的颜色 OpenGL ES 混合发生在片元通过各项测试之后,准备进入帧缓冲区的片元和原有的片元按照特定比例加权计算出最终片元的颜色值,不再是新&#xf…

Codeforces Round 920 (Div. 3)

D. Very Different Array(贪心双指针/前缀和) 思路:绝对值就是线段-->让线段最长(肯定是越在最短端找最右端的 越最右端找最左端的)-->判断怎么连哪段最长(采用双指针的策略去判断) (左红…

Swift Combine 通过用户输入更新声明式 UI 从入门到精通十五

Combine 系列 Swift Combine 从入门到精通一Swift Combine 发布者订阅者操作者 从入门到精通二Swift Combine 管道 从入门到精通三Swift Combine 发布者publisher的生命周期 从入门到精通四Swift Combine 操作符operations和Subjects发布者的生命周期 从入门到精通五Swift Com…

uniapp前端手机获取安全区域css值 防止按键不能被点击

引入 再编写小程序和移动端的时候可能会出现这种情况,页面中的按键刚好才手机中按不到的位置 如下 这是苹果手机的home按键 如果刚好我们的按钮再这个位置,用户是点击不到的 我们就需要一个办法,能够自动的让我们的按键移动到安全可点击的区域 解决 我们可以使用…

第四篇:SQL语法-DDL-数据定义语言

大年初一限定篇😀 (祝广大IT学习者、工作者0 error 0 warning!) DDL英文全称是Data Definition Language(数据定义语言),用来定义关系模式、删除关系、修改关系模式以及创建数据库中的各种对象 …